> And the best place to have one serviced?
David,
I had my speedo repaired and calibrated at Palo Alto Speedometer.
www.paspeedo.com
For about a hundred and twenty five bucks they did a great job. I had mine
recalibrated to precisely match my new tires. Very accurate, no bounce,
looks great. Highly recommended. I'm planning to send the Tachometer to them
as I think it's off and they did such a great job on the speedometer.
